[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]the average legroom or pitch has decreased from a comfortable 35 inches to a cramped 28 inches, often found on low-cost carriers. Seat width has also shrunk by as much as four inches over the past 30 years, leaving many seats with a narrow 16-inch width. https://www.travelpulse.com/news/airlines-airports/shrinking-seat-sizes-and-disappearing-legroom-impacting-airline-experience-for-americans#:~:text=Consider%20this%3A%20the%20average%20legroom,a%20narrow%2016%2Dinch%20width. Supposedly they're slowly starting to increase again.[/quote] That's more like what I remember. A small roller would fit in front of my feet, and I'd tuck a small purse at the lower curve of my back when buckled in (mostly because it was more comfortable that way). Interesting that it's changing. The whole "gate lice"/juggling for line position seems tied to baggage issues and getting room for carry-ons. I'm sure the market will continue to adapt.
